My Buying Guides on Bed Frame White Queen

Why I Chose a White Queen Bed Frame

When I started looking for a new bed frame, I wanted something that felt clean, bright, and easy to style. A white queen bed frame stood out to me because it gives the bedroom a fresh look and works well with almost any color scheme. I also liked that it could make my room feel more open, especially since white reflects light nicely.

What I Looked for in the Material

One of the first things I checked was the frame material. I found that white queen bed frames usually come in wood, metal, or upholstered designs. For my needs, I wanted something sturdy and long-lasting. Metal frames felt durable and easy to maintain, while wooden frames gave a warmer, more classic look. Upholstered frames looked stylish, but I made sure to think about cleaning before choosing one.

Size and Room Fit Matter to Me

Since I needed a queen size, I measured my bedroom carefully before buying. I learned that even though a queen bed is a standard size, the frame itself can take up more space depending on the design. I made sure there was enough room for walking around the bed, opening drawers, and placing nightstands. That helped me avoid a frame that would make the room feel crowded.

Style Was Important in My Decision

I wanted a bed frame that matched my bedroom’s overall style. Some white queen bed frames have a modern minimalist look, while others feel more traditional or farmhouse-inspired. I paid attention to the headboard and footboard design because those details can completely change the feel of the room. For me, the style had to look good but also feel timeless.

Storage Options Helped Me Decide

I considered whether I wanted extra storage under the bed. Some white queen bed frames come with built-in drawers or enough clearance for storage bins. That was appealing to me because I always appreciate saving space. If someone has a smaller bedroom, I think storage features can make a big difference.

Assembly Was Something I Checked First

I didn’t want a bed frame that would be frustrating to put together. So I looked for one with clear instructions, simple hardware, and good customer reviews about assembly. In my experience, a frame that is easy to assemble saves a lot of time and stress. I also made sure I had the right tools before starting.

Durability and Support Were Non-Negotiable

A bed frame should support both the mattress and the people using it, so I paid close attention to weight capacity and construction quality. I wanted something that wouldn’t squeak or wobble over time. A strong center support system was especially important to me because it adds stability and helps the mattress last longer.

How I Thought About Maintenance

Because I chose white, I knew maintenance would matter. I looked for finishes that were easy to wipe clean and resistant to stains or scratches. If the frame had fabric, I made sure I was comfortable with regular vacuuming or spot cleaning. I found that choosing a finish I could maintain easily made the bed frame feel like a better long-term purchase.
